Another complication of this inflammation, namely, fetal inflammatory response syndrome (FIRS), occurs when a fetus mounts its own inflammatory response when exposed to intrauterine infection. FIRS is characterized by elevated umbilical cord blood mediators of inflammation, including IL-6 and IL-1β, ...
